IMPORTANT:

  Before removing the Boiler Cap or Filter Holder slowly open the 

Steam Control Knob to relieve any pressure left in the Boiler. To remove the 
Filter Holder turn the handle to the left and lower.  Hold the Metal Filter in 
place by pushing the Filter Holder Lock onto the rim of the Metal Filter.  Coffee 
can now be tapped out while the Metal Filter is held in place. 

 

STEAM ONLY  

 
If you only want to froth milk, fill the Espresso Carafe with water up to the Steam 
Cloud.  This will give you approximately one minute of steaming.   
1. Make sure the Strength Control Knob is set to the Steam symbol.  
2. Pour the water in the Boiler and press the Espresso/Cappuccino On/Off 

button. 

3. Place an empty cup under the Steam Nozzle to collect any water which may 

escape.   

4. Fill a narrow pitcher half full with fresh, cold milk (the colder the better).  Low 

fat or skim milk works best.  As soon as the Steam Indicator Light comes on, 
slowly turn the Steam Control Knob counterclockwise to open the steam valve.  
Move the pitcher up and down, keeping the tip of the Frothing Nozzle just 
below the surface of the milk to produce the best froth and avoid splattering.  

5. Once the milk has been frothed, turn the Steam Control Knob clockwise to 

close the valve and remove the pitcher. 

6. Turn the appliance off by pressing the Espresso/Cappuccino On/Off Button.   

The light will go out. 

7. To clean the steam tube, turn the Espresso Strength Control Dial to the Light 

position and slowly open the Steam Control Knob.  

8. Before removing the Filter Holder or the Boiler Cap be sure that there is no 

pressure left in the Boiler by slowly opening the Steam Control Knob.
